Fossil Discovery Offers Rare Glimpse Into T. rex's Final Moments

A newly discovered dinosaur skull with a T. rex tooth embedded reveals crucial evidence of a predatory attack, providing insights into prehistoric life and behavior.

Understanding the Discovery

In a shocking development for paleontologists, a remarkable fossil discovery has come to light. A dinosaur skull, unearthed with a Tyrannosaurus rex tooth still lodged in its face, provides tangible evidence of a T. rex hunting scenario frozen in time for 66 million years. This unique find not only sheds light on the predatory behaviors of one of history's most formidable carnivores but also offers an unprecedented opportunity to study the dynamics of predator-prey interactions.
